kdf: Restructure KDF test vectors
* tests/t-kdf.c: Restructure KDF test vectors to allow easy addition new vectors. Also remove some ugly C code like goto again.
[jk: fixed commit changelog cipher/kdf.c -> tests/t-kdf.c]
- Signed-off-by: Jussi Kivilinna <jussi.kivilinna@iki.fi>